Chandrayaan-3: The Indian Space Research Organisation (ISRO) successfully performed a unique experiment in which it made Chandrayaan-3's propulsion module perform a successful detour, bringing it from lunar orbit to Earth's orbit. The propulsion module performed an orbit-raising manoeuvre and a trans-Earth injection manoeuvre, following which it was placed in an Earth-bound orbit, ISRO said in a mission update on X (formerly Twitter).
